When it comes to taking care of commercial properties, property owners, and managers put much focus on the maintenance of the buildings that they are in charge of. Maintenance of buildings is important, but it’s also essential not to overlook the grounds of your property. Doing so could make a negative impression on customers, tenants, visitors, and potential buyers. Landscaping can go a long way in increasing the value of your commercial property– think curb appeal!

Landscaping Tips to Increase Commercial Property Value

Here are a few helpful tips to improve the value of your commercial property with landscaping.

Keep It Green: Improving the landscaping of your commercial property does not have to involve major complicated tasks. The best way to enhance the curb appeal of your property, and increase its value, is to make sure that any grass lawn area is at its greenest. Keep in mind that this does not mean that your maintenance crew needs to wait for weeds to pop up. Add Variety: Green grass will look great and will improve property valueespecially if watered efficiently and to a budget (using the correct amount of water and when to apply it). However, you need more to make your grounds look lively and appealing if you want to give your commercial property value a boost. Add variety to your landscaping with trees, flowers, and plants. Adding color to your landscaping will make your property more inviting and do wonders to increase its market value.Choosing the correct plant for the right place based upon its horticultural needs and mature size will lower maintenance costs while improving curb appeal.

Create an Outdoor Seating Area: If your commercial property does not already have an outdoor common area, you should consider creating one. Gazebos, patios, and other seating areas may be a good investment, as they can recoup more than the amount you spent to have them installed. Outdoor areas that have added ornamental or functional features recover significantly more than their initial investments. A water feature, dining area, or pergola is sure to increase your property value, and impress customers, tenants, and visitors alike. If you are looking to improve the value of your commercial property, you should consider investing on features and enhancements on your landscaping. Keeping the outdoor area of your commercial property clean, well maintained, and appealing will go a long way in boosting its curb appeal and its market value.
